One thing that bites newcomers: sort stability. The Copperline report builder uses a stable sort everywhere, on purpose. Rows with equal keys keep their original ingest order, and customers depend on that for tie-breaking. Never swap in an unstable sort for performance, and never re-sort partial result pages independently. If you add a new column type, its comparator must be deterministic and documented. Test fixtures for equal-key ordering are mandatory. The full rationale and comparator guidelines are on the page below.

wiki page, tahaf-tajog: https://jira.ordindyn.corp/pipeline

Ticket: Staging env misconfigured for Siftgate bloom filter

The bloom layer in front of the Pellet KV store is rejecting all lookups in staging because the env file was copied from the dev template without credentials. False-positive tuning values are fine; only the auth line is missing. To unblock the weekly demo, the Pellet admission secret must be set on the following line.

env line for yaguf-fajop: LEDGER_TOKEN13=fb08984397349

## Runbook: Catalogue Import (Shelfwise)

The nightly import pulls the Brindlemere library catalogue and merges it into the Shelfwise index. If the job stalls, it's usually a malformed MARC batch — quarantine the offending file and rerun; the importer is idempotent, so don't worry about duplicates. Keep an eye on the dedupe pass, it's the slow bit. The importer runs with the configuration values shown below.

settings of tajep-tafog:
CASDOR_LOG_LEVEL=info
CASDOR_METRICS_HOST=metrics.casdor.nelvrosys.internal
CASDOR_POOL_SIZE=16

Ticket #—missed pick-up, Varnholt tour props

Courier no-show yesterday at the Larkspill Theatre loading dock. Crates of stage props for the Varnholt touring show are still in the corridor and blocking access. Show opens Saturday in Drummond Vale; these must move tomorrow, no later than 09:00. Rebooked with Stonepath Freight — priority flag set. Crates are sealed and counted; manifest taped to crate one. Dispatch: confirm the driver checks in at the stage door first. On arrival, give the driver this confidential instruction:

handover note for yagef-bagep: the drudor pelius courier leaves the kasdor zorvan norir ledger at gate 8016 under passcode 755406